					<description><![CDATA[What are the hidden risks associated with Electric Vehicles (EVs)? Multi-shop owner and District Chief of the Troy Fire Department Donnie Hudson and mechanical engineer and Captain of the Troy Fire Department, Pat Durham, discuss the importance of awareness and proper training for EVs. EV fires can be complex and involve risks of corrosion, and short circuits. Education and training are crucial for firefighters, first responders, and automotive professionals to ensure EV safety. Working on EVs can also have insurance implications, with potential surcharges. Despite the risks, being prepared and knowledgeable about EVs is critical when handling damaged vehicles.

<li>The importance of proper towing for EVs (00:05:30) Why EVs should only be towed on a flatbed and the risks of towing them in other ways.</li>
<li>The potential dangers of EV fires and battery corrosion (00:02:43) Exploration of the risks associated with EV fires, including the potential for battery corrosion and subsequent fires.</li>
<li>The need for training and education on EVs (00:06:42) Discussion on the lack of training for firefighters, first responders, and technicians on EVs, and the importance of staying ahead of the growing popularity of EVs.</li>
<li>The surcharge for EVs (00:08:02) Discussion on the insurance surcharge for working on and storing EVs overnight.</li>
<li>The safety of EVs after a crash (00:08:44) The increased risk of fire and other catastrophic events in EVs after they have been in a crash.</li>
<li>Concerns about aftermarket batteries (00:10:31) The potential risks and dangers associated with aftermarket batteries in EVs.</li>
<li>The ineffectiveness of water in extinguishing EV fires (00:17:10) The misconception that water can put out EV fires.</li>
<li>The potential risks and limitations of using piercing nozzles (00:21:28)</li>
<li>The importance of immediate action after a crash (00:23:52)</li>
<li>Inspecting for road debris damage (00:25:38) The impact of road debris on EVs, including the need to inspect for visible damage and the measures taken by manufacturers to protect battery enclosures.</li>
<li>Inspecting EV components on a lift (00:27:52) The need for thorough inspections of EV components, such as the battery, wires, connections, and electric motors, and the importance of documenting any issues for customer safety.</li>
<li>Importance of understanding high voltage (00:32:25) The need for proper knowledge and safety precautions when working with high voltage in EVs.</li>

<p>Key Talking Points:</p>
<ul>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Fire in business- January 15thThe vehicle came into the shop in the evening to be serviced the following day</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Everyone left before 6 pm, by 6:25 pm the fire department was called by passerby pedestrian</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">The shop had security cameras but no smoke detectors.</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Engine compartment towards 12volt battery of vehicle was where fire had started&nbsp;&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">The building doesn’t have to be rebuilt but the rafters and trusses are damaged- heat tempers wood and it loses its “binding’ properties&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Was newer vehicle- depending on cause this is how recalls are createdAn insurance investigator and manufacturer investigator- the vehicle will often be taken off-site to have a thorough forensic investigation to find out the cause</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Luckily there weren’t significant damages to the tools/equipment/diagnostic machine, inventory and employee tools/equipment &#8211; you’re facing fire/smoke and water damage from fire department&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Expected to be fully operational again by mid-late Fall 2021&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Business interruption insurance&nbsp;Looks at what your business was producing prior to the interruption&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">A fixed amount of money to be pulled for paychecks etc&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">2 bays- tech works 40 hours a week, bill out 20 hours working in the bay (shop pays from own checkbook from funding) the other 20 hours they are cleaning/inventorying the shop and ‘working for insurance’&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">What you can do ahead of time- be proactive&nbsp;Invite fire marshall to come to shop- document shop layout/entrances&nbsp;&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Fire trucks have tablets in them- when they get called to a location any information about the building can be used&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Purchase from fire department safe for outside of building with keycodes to avoid damage from entering during emergency&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Map out your disconnects- gas/water/electricity&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">30-45 seconds can make the difference between going from bad to really bad in a fire</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Research and become familiar with your insurance coverage plan and educate your employees on it- can they get homeowners insurance on their equipment?&nbsp;&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Inventory what you have in the shop- what is the cost of replacement?&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Consider ‘cleanup’ investments after a disaster&nbsp;</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Also, consider fire doors</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Link fire detectors to EMS</li>

<p><strong>Key Talking Points:</strong></p>
<ol>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Who can I call to review my insurance to make sure I have everything I need and compare what I have to what others in my industry may have?Your agent is a critical advisor to you</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">You must trust them. Have lunch. Look them in the eye</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Find a specialist, if you can, in the automotive industry</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">You don’t know what you don’t know. You may not know what to ask that is why a strong relationship with an agent will bring more to the table</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">What if my building burns down – are my tools covered? Are my clients’ cars covered? Are my employee’s wages covered? Is my lost revenue covered?At fault, not at fault</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">David says co-insurance is important.You’ll need to be close to the value of building on coverage</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Actual rebuild costs, you need to be covered up to 80%</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">Business interruption for income is criticalYou can get 12 months actual loss sustained</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">Keeping you even</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Read the fine print</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Look at replacement costs of new equipment</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">COVID19Your policies may have a virus/bacteria exclusion</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Workman’s comp may have a ‘disease at work clause’</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">The natural course of events should not be part of your Workmans comp</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">What if we have an accident in a client car? Is the car covered, are the other people covered, is my driver covered? What if there’s damage to another property?You did the work on a client’s car and something happened. You’ll want comprehensive coverage.</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Liability will also cover if the client is driving</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">Test drives:Non-owned auto liability</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Workmans Comp can come into play</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">There is Garage Keepers coverage</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">Consider an umbrella policy to cover catastrophic claimsBuy coverage based on your appetite for risk</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">David sees catastrophic claims $3-5 Million</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">Umbrellas do not fill gaps. It extends what you already have</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Tough to suggest what coverage to get. Your appetite for risk</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Consider a personal umbrella also to cover you personally</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Insurance follows the vehicle</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Look at drive other car coverage for your business</li>
<li>Sexual harassment needs to be an endorsed rider</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">What if my employee is hurt at work?Workmans Comp</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">States track your claims and you get an experience modification</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">Should you self insure small claims, cuts/bruises (a suggestion not the rule)Ask your agent and look at your experience</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Let your agent guide you on filing claim</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">A customer gets hurt on your property (rent or own)If you are leasing, you must read your lease to understand your liability</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">The landlord can demand you have certain coverage and umbrellas</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">You need to be sure your landlord has insurance</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">What if we blow up a motor? Is the damage covered?Carrier can say you touched the engine it is your fault</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">You need to look at ‘mechanics errors and omissions’ coverage</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Also’ broad form product’ coverage on your general liability</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Do I need commercial umbrella insurance? What does it cover? Is there a place where there is too much coverage and we become sexy for lawsuits?See #4 above</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Cannot get calls or the internet or power to run the tools?Look at the fine print of your policy</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Big storm, power is out. But why? Flood? (possibly no coverage)</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Many policies exclude overhead transmission lines. 9 of 10 polices do not cover overhead transmission lines</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">What if there is a big hail storm and it damages all our company cars and client cars outside?Need comprehensive coverage for your cars</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">There will be a deductible fr the company cars</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">A stop loss on your garage keepers coverage</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Direct and primary coverage has a limitActual cash value for replacement</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Look at your flood coverageAnyone can have a flood</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">What if someone accuses us of unfair employment practices?Employment-related practices policy or endorsement</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Wrongful dismissal</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Unfair hiring practices</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Sexual Harassment</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Discrimination</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">A third party. An outsider comes to your place. Look at this coverage.</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Critical to have a handbook and procedures manual that describes how all of these claims are managed</li>

<p><strong>Key Talking Points:</strong></p>
<ul>
<li>Insurance is a contract between the business and the insurance company</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">Two typesPhysical propertyWhat you own</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Your Customers property</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">LiabilityYou are responsible for damage to others and their property</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">You have more responsibility than an individual</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">When you hire someone you say you trust that person</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">When they do something wrong the liability is on you.</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">These claims are going through the roof</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Yearly audits are done with your agent. Sometimes twice. They may ask:Are there name change</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">New property</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Mailing address</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Changes in equipment</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Look at revenue</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Changes in payroll</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Look at loaners and the limits you want</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">And many more</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">LoanersYou must check if your customer has a valid license</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">You must check if they have valid insurance</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">No different than a rental car contract</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">You need to get a signed agreement with the customer on the use of the loaner car. Your insurance company can get you a version (vehicle usage/release form)</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">You may need a declaration page or insurance card. Verify with your insurance carrier to the proper way to cover yourself.</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">If the insurance isn’t paid, they have no insurance even though you may see an insurance card. You can call the customers agent to send you a declaration of insurance</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Some customers can go through their app to send you a declaration</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">How Insurance pays outThere are certain types of coverageReplacement cost. Like, Kind, QualityConsider taking a higher deductable</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Actual cash valueTake the depreciated amount out</li>
<li class="ql-indent-3">DeductiblesThere is a hidden value in deductiblesWorkmans compUpfront saving</li>
<li class="ql-indent-2">Can prevent your MOD rating by paying a portion (experience rating)</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">The number of claims increases your premiums. Higher deductibles can save you money, however, your exposure is higher</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Good processes and quality programs help minimize your risk</li>
<li>Report all claims. You can make it report only. Get it on record, you can always pull the claim.</li>
<li>Cost management: Insurance deductibles and coverage</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Business and persona umbrella policy is a givenUmbrella policies sit above all other policies and provide you additional coverage</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">With insurance, you get what you pay forWorking with an agent face to face is a huge value to your business</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Business interruption insuranceConsider the length of time you may need. It will always be longer</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">If you don’t report all your income then you also have a gap you’ll need to deal with. Get all your sales on the books</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Nothing good happens after midnight</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">Have proper limits</li>
<li class="ql-indent-1">You should ‘What If’ with your insurance agentWhat Happens If ….</li>
